It's kinda like adding a smidge of dessert into the middle of the meal. Basically there are 3 components that I use to make this small helping of fruit dip.
Here's the scoop:
3 Tablespoons of Cream Cheese softened
2 Tablespoons Non-fat Vanilla Yogurt
1 Tablespoon of sugar
In a small bowl scoop in approximately 3 Tbsp of cream cheese. If it's not soft and creamy, throw it in the microwave for a few seconds.
Now add 2 Tablespoons of Non-Fat Vanilla Yogurt
Lastly add 1 Tablespoon of Sugar and mix well.
Just a dollop on top of a small bowl of fruit will go a long way. Yum!
Also, if you don't have any yogurt on hand, but happen to have one of those small servings of pre-made vanilla pudding, you can replace the yogurt AND sugar for 2 Tbsp of vanilla pudding. Enjoy! :-)
